Damian Lillard returned to action in Game 6 of the Milwaukee Bucks- Indiana Pacers series Thursday night, hoping that he would be able to help his team stave off elimination. Instead, he got cooked by…wait for it…TJ McConnell.

Lillard is an eight-time NBA All-Star and a member of the NBA 75th Anniversary Team, accolades McConnell can only dream of. But in Game 6, McConnell did not just keep up with the Bucks superstar point guard; he outplayed him.

Damian Lillard Flamed by the Internet After Getting Outplayed by Indiana Pacers’ TJ McConnell 

To be fair to Lillard, he probably was still not at his 100 percent form in Game 6 after missing two games with an Achilles issue. He did score 28 points but was just 7/17 from the floor in 35 minutes of action. McConnell, on the other hand, came off the bench and fired 22 points on much more efficient 7/9 shooting from the field with nine assists and a plus/minus of +22 in just 23 minutes.
